Are changes in the state of matter (phase) considered physical or chemical changes? Why?

Answers

Answer:

Physical changes

Explanation:

Changes in the state of matter are physical changes.

First, the material is made up of the same components that is was before it changed states.

The physical properties of the material changed, but its chemical composition did not, meaning that is is a physical change.

Answer:

Physical change

Explanation:

Matter can change between phases, so they are reversible physical changes that do not change matter’s chemical composition.

Changes of state are physical changes in matter. They are reversible changes that do not change matter’s chemical makeup or chemical properties. Water, for example, can be a solid (ice), a liquid (drinking water), or a gas (steam). Those are physical changes that don't change the fact that water is always chemically made up of H2O (two hydrogens and one oxygen).

leo is comparing carbon 12 and carbon 14 atoms which particles make these isotopes have different mass numbers

Answers

Carbon-12 (or 12C) contains six protons, six neutrons, and six electrons; therefore, it has a mass number of 12 amu (six protons and six neutrons). Carbon-14 (or 14C) contains six protons, eight neutrons, and six electrons; its atomic mass is 14 amu (six protons and eight neutrons).

A sample of water has a volume of 24.0 milliliters and a density of 0.992 g/mL. What is its mass? 1) 23.8 g 2) 24.2 g 3) NONE

Answers

Answer:

23.8

Explanation:

The formula for density is D=M/V, where D stands for density, M stands for mass, and V stands for volume. In this case, we are solving for mass, so we have to cross multiply the equation to isolate the variable of M. Once we cross multiply, we get the equation M=DV, and then we start to substitute the values into the equation. M=(.992g/mL)(24.0mL) is the equation, and once we multiply, we get 23.808 as the answer. But when figuring out density, mass, or volume, we need to utilize sig figs. Since the two numbers that you are multiplying both have 3 sig figs, the answer must have three sig figs. Round up or down based on the place value that you are rounding to. Since we are trying to get an answer that is in the tenths place, we round down to 23.8, which is the answer.
